Chilwa Minerals Limited is an Australia-based mineral exploration company. The Company has an interest in the Chilwa Project, which is located on the shores of Lake Chilwa in Malawi. The Chilwa Project is located on two separate exploration licenses (EL), which include EL 0671/22 (Chilwa Island), which covers an area of approximately 12.84 square kilometers, and EL 0670/22 (Lake Chilwa), which covers an area of 865.56 square kilometers. The Chilwa Project contains four prospects, including Halala/Namanja, Mposa, Bimbi and Mpyupy. Halala/Namanja prospect is to the north of Lake Chilwa, which is incised by several rivers and has an east-west strike of 20 kilometers. Mposa prospect is located on the western shore of Lake Chilwa and is approximately six kilometers long and 300 meters wide. Bimbi prospect is located on the southwest shore of Lake Chilwa. Mpyupyu prospect is situated to the south of Bimbi and consists of three separate mineralized zones.
